Badin vs Acajutla Climate & Distance Between

El Salvador flag
  • The distance between Badin, Pakistan and Acajutla, El Salvador is approximately 15,180 km or 9,433 mi.
  • To reach Badin in this distance one would set out from Acajutla bearing 28.6°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Badin bearing 149.2° or SSE .
  • Badin has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Acajutla has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
  • Badin is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ome whereas Acajutla is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 0.2 °C (0.4°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.7 °C (22.9°F) more in Badin.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1534.8 mm (60.4 in) less which is equivalent to 1534.8 l/m² (37.67 US gal/ft²) or 15,348,000 l/ha (1,640,803 US gal/ac) less. About 1/8 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 7.1° lower in Badin than in Acajutla.
